About Casa Blanco
A Unique Blend of Spanish Minimalism and Mexican Color
A young couple, eager to start a family, envisioned a new family home that combined their cultural backgrounds and personal tastes. The husband, Spanish in origin, appreciated black and white minimalism, while the Mexican wife desired vibrant color in a modern setting. Their previous home in the Maryland suburbs, a small and dimly lit space, failed to capitalize on the picturesque parkway behind it. The couple’s design solution involved demolishing the existing house, retaining the basement, and constructing a two-story home with a double-height living area, abundant natural light, and captivating views.
